(VOVworld) – Around 60 US aircrafts including F/A-18 combat aircraft and early warning squadron E-2C will be moved from Atsugi airbase to another base in Iwakuni city, Japan.

The move aims to reduce noise in Atsugi, which is located in an urban area. After the relocation, the number of US soldiers and their family members in Iwakuni city will exceed 10,000, accounting for 10 percent of the city’s population. Some F35 stealth jet fighters will also be deployed to the Iwakuni base later this month.
